Has anyone had issues using Pulse at public or hosted wifi areas? like conferences that use portals.
I have a few users now at a conference that are able to log on to the network via the portal, able to browse and even get email via https. But they cannot fire up Junos Pulse.
It says disconnected- manual override (when they open it.)
When they attempt to connect, it says "Hotspot restricting network access - manual override "
So it doesnt even get to the authentication part.
I am unable to actually be on their laptops to run tests, but is this just simply the enviroment/network equipment etc that is preventing the access or is this something that can be fixed?
Any assistance would be greatly appreciated.
Running Version (Pulse Secure 5.1.1 (52267)

It is recommended to upgrade to 8.1R3.2 and disable captive portal feature.
This was not a option in the previous release.
